WebPinca (also pogača, sirnica or pinza or ´´´Osterpinze’´´) is a traditional Dalmatian, Istrian, Bay of Kotor and Austria Easter sweet roll.It is also popular in the Goriška region of Slovenia, the Slovenian Littoral, western Croatia in parts of the Province of Trieste and Gorizia of Italy and of Austria..
